Ok, the workaround works. However, you cannot EVER in the same session have live weather activated from the welcome screen. You MUST start your first flight with the workaround in place, then the second flight the workaround works. If you start your first flight with live weather chosen from the welcome screen, the workaround will NOT work in subsequent flights. Wish I’d realized that earlier lol!

Can anyone repro this current bug for me with a possible video recording on the latest build? I’m talking to our team about it and would love to help them nail the issue down more.

For those that have the issue, it’s easy. To make sure it wasn’t something with Simbrief, which I normally use, I also tested manually entering a flight plan.

  1. At world map go to flight conditions and set live weather on your first flight. Doesn’t matter if you use live players, all players, off under MP. Also doesn’t matter if you which air traffic you use.

  2. Start flight…you can then exit out to main menu once you spawn in.

  3. Choose another flight, spawn in and 29.92 and clear skies.

100% reproduceable. No mystery or steps needed. I’m not going to bother to do a video as it’s really that easy. I can also confirm that I play at two difference locations 40 miles apart, one with DSL 15mb download/.750 upload and at another place with 400mb DL/80mb upload so I don’t think it’s network related.

Most of us work around having to restart after each flight by choosing preset clear skies on your first flight, then changing to live weather once inside the cockpit. 100% fixes the issues as long as you remember to change to live weather inside the sim every flight.
